Understanding The 5S System For The Office

The 5S System serves as visual shorthand for five steps to help companies eliminate waste, gain control over the workplace, and ensure that processes are being followed as efficiently as possible.

The five steps include:
  • Sort: Go through your team’s workspace to identify which tools and areas are essential. Eliminate all distractions and waste.
  • Straighten: Optimize your workspace organization, with every tool in the exact spot where it’s needed most. Provide clear guidelines to your employees on how the workspace should be organized at all times.
  • Shine: Establish cleaning routines and plans that keep your facility up to company, industry, and regulatory standards–at all times, and with minimum time spent.
  • Standardize: Share simple, visual guides to your most important company goals and processes that reduce mistakes, eliminate wasted time, and make it easy for your team to always follow procedure.
  • Sustain: Take the necessary steps to ensure that your 5S-related improvements are sustainable over the long-term.
Visual Management: Improving Performance and Communication

Lean visual management systems like 5S are designed to provide effective information flow and communication through visual signals and controls, which allow your organization to perform at the highest levels. Management clearly communicates its most important priorities. Workers always have a quick, easy-to-understand reference to guide them through the steps of a complex process or make informed decisions about what to do next in their work.

Forward-thinking organizations understand the concept of building stability and improving capability through safe and effective Visual Management and Visual Control Systems. 5S–and other lean approaches to visual management–can help companies to optimize their workspace and improve the flow of information.
